1-Month Starter Plan

Pick one small action from each area every week. Add the next step when the first feels easy.


1. Food

WeekDo this
1Add one fruit or veg to every meal. Drink one extra glass of water.
2Build each plate: ½ veggies, ¼ protein (beans, eggs, fish, lean meat), ¼ whole carbs (oats, brown rice).
3Swap sugary drinks for water, sparkling water, or unsweetened tea. Prep tomorrow’s lunch tonight.
4Try a 12-hour eating window (e.g., 7 a.m.–7 p.m.). Keep water nearby all day.

Quick tips

  • Buy frozen veggies; they’re cheap and fast.
  • Keep fruit in sight so you grab it first.
  • Season with herbs, lemon, or vinegar instead of heavy sauces.

2. Movement

WeekDo this
1Walk 10 minutes right after two meals each day.
2Add two 15-minute body-weight sessions (squats, wall push-ups, chair sit-stands).
3Walk 30 minutes total most days. Keep body-weight work twice.
4Turn one walk into intervals: 1 min brisk / 1 min easy for 20 minutes. Do body-weight work three times.

Quick tips

  • Set calendar alarms so you don’t forget the walk.
  • Use a stable chair for support if moves feel hard.
  • Stretch tight spots (calves, chest) for 30 seconds after activity.

3. Rest & Recovery

WeekDo this
1Fix a bedtime and wake-up time; aim for 7–8 hours. Phone off 30 min before bed.
2Create a wind-down routine: dim lights, light stretching, read a few pages.
3Add a 5-minute slow-breathing session once a day (in for 4 sec, out for 6 sec).
4Take one tech-free hour each evening. Use it to walk, journal, or talk with someone.

Quick tips

  • Keep the bedroom cool, dark, and quiet.
  • If thoughts race, jot them on paper, then close the notebook.
  • Short daylight breaks improve sleep at night.

How to track

  • Use a simple checklist or notes app.
  • Mark each action you finish.
  • Review every Sunday; keep what works, drop what doesn’t.

Start small, stay consistent. Little wins each day build long-term health.
